During the late 19th and early 20th centuries, the United States expanded its influence internationally, particularly in the Caribbean and the Pacific. Major events of this time include the annexation of Hawaii in 1898, the Spanish-American War, and the subsequent acquisition of territories such as Puerto Rico, Guam, and the Philippines. This expansionism was often justified through concepts such as Manifest Destiny and the belief in the superiority of American civilization.
